Find the sum of `-8 , 23,-32, -17 " and " -63`.

Text Solution

AI Generated Solution

The correct Answer is:
To find the sum of the integers -8, 23, -32, -17, and -63, we will follow these steps: ### Step 1: Write down the expression We start with the expression: \[ -8 + 23 + (-32) + (-17) + (-63) \] ### Step 2: Combine the positive and negative numbers First, we will combine the positive number (23) with the negative number (-8): \[ -8 + 23 = 15 \] So now we have: \[ 15 + (-32) + (-17) + (-63) \] ### Step 3: Add the next negative number Now, we will add -32 to 15: \[ 15 + (-32) = 15 - 32 = -17 \] Now the expression is: \[ -17 + (-17) + (-63) \] ### Step 4: Add the next negative number Next, we will add -17 to -17: \[ -17 + (-17) = -34 \] Now we have: \[ -34 + (-63) \] ### Step 5: Add the last negative number Finally, we will add -63 to -34: \[ -34 + (-63) = -34 - 63 = -97 \] ### Final Answer The sum of -8, 23, -32, -17, and -63 is: \[ \boxed{-97} \] ---
